Transaction 02ab74b80b147768d6d6423f163303af59b95885c1960cde54ac76b369aa7426
1 Input
1 Output
-
02ab74b80b147768d6d6423f163303af59b95885c1960cde54ac76b369aa7426:0
- value
- 124238
- script pubkey
- OP_0 OP_PUSHBYTES_20 58b90a541bc86032bc25b1ff08a5ac5ba09baa3f
- address
- bc1qtzus54qmepsr90p9k8ls3fdvtwsfh23lh8q396